Understanding ADHD in Adults
ADHD is identified by signs of inattention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. In adults, these symptoms might manifest in a different way than in children. Adult ADHD can cause troubles in numerous locations of life, consisting of work, relationships, and everyday obligations. Numerous grownups with ADHD might not have actually been detected in childhood, frequently leading to misconceptions and obstacles throughout their lives.

The process for identifying ADHD in adults in the UK usually involves several phases:
1. Initial Consultation
The initial step normally includes a preliminary assessment with a healthcare expert, such as a GP or a mental health professional. During this appointment, the individual discusses their issues, signs, and [How To Get ADHD Diagnosis As An Adult](http://106.55.61.128:3000/diagnosis-of-adhd-in-adults0157) these symptoms impact their every day life.
2. Comprehensive Assessment
If ADHD is suspected, the health care professional will conduct a thorough evaluation. This may consist of:
Clinical interviews: To check out signs, household history, and personal history.Standardized surveys: Tools like the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S) might be used to examine the signs.Collateral information: Gathering insights from member of the family or partners might also be considered to gain a broader point of view on the person's behavior.3. Diagnosis
Based on the evaluation results, the health care expert will identify whether the requirements for ADHD, as outlined in the DSM-5 (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ders), are fulfilled. This may include dismissing other mental health conditions that might discuss the symptoms.
4. Conversation of Treatment Options
If diagnosed, the doctor will go over various treatment options, which can include behavioral treatments, psychoeducation, and medication. This is a critical action in guaranteeing the individual receives appropriate support customized to their needs.
Obstacles in the Diagnosis Process
Regardless of increased awareness, several obstacles remain in detecting ADHD in adults:
